Arbitrage trading is a strategy that exploits price differences across different markets, platforms or times to capture risk-free or low-risk profits. In forex markets, includes triangular arbitrage (exploiting exchange rate differences among three currencies), cross-platform arbitrage (exploiting quote differences between brokers), etc. The strategy requires fast execution and advanced technical support.
Price differences: Identify price differences across markets or platforms
Fast execution: Requires extremely fast execution speed to capture arbitrage opportunities
Low risk: Theoretically risk-free or low-risk strategy
Technical requirements: Requires advanced trading systems and algorithms
Rare opportunities: Arbitrage opportunities usually disappear quickly
Arbitrage trading is mainly used by institutional investors and high-frequency traders, requiring advanced technical systems and substantial capital. In forex markets, triangular arbitrage is the most common form. Due to modern market efficiency, arbitrage opportunities are increasingly rare and short-lived.
Theoretically risk-free or low-risk; not dependent on market direction; can be automated; stable profits.
Opportunities are rare and short-lived; requires advanced technical systems; trading costs may offset profits; requires substantial capital; intense competition.
When using arbitrage strategy, note: ensure execution speed is fast enough; consider all trading costs; beware of platform and liquidity risks; some brokers may prohibit arbitrage trading; technical failures may cause losses; market condition changes may invalidate arbitrage; requires continuous monitoring and system maintenance.
